1. Share a Screen or Window
Entry point: Meeting interface → bottom toolbar → Share
- Join a meeting and click the Share button on the bottom toolbar.
- Select the content type you want to share: desktop or app window.
- Turn on Share computer audio or Improve screen-sharing frame rate if needed.
- Click Confirm to start sharing.
- When you finish, click Stop Sharing on the floating sharing toolbar.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: Participants can see the desktop or app window you selected.
- What you can do next: You can continue presenting files, playing content, or switching pages.
- No side effects: The meeting continues after you stop sharing.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: If you do not confirm the correct window before sharing, unrelated content may be shown.
- Environment note: Before sharing audio, make sure your Mac audio output is working normally.
2. Add Annotations
Entry point: Shared screen interface → top floating toolbar → annotation options
- Start screen sharing first.
- On the top floating toolbar, click Annotation Options.
- Choose Mouse, Pen, Highlighter, Eraser, or Clear as needed.
- Mark directly on the shared screen.
- After the explanation, continue sharing or exit the sharing session.
Success Criteria
- Interface result: The markup appears on the shared screen.
- What you can do next: You can switch tools, erase content, or clear all markup.
- No side effects: Annotation does not interrupt the meeting.
Tips While Using
- Common mistake: If screen sharing has not started, the annotation flow is not available.
- Environment note: Annotation works properly when the shared screen is displayed normally.
